How to Access Documents and Settings Folder in Vista Home Premium

I need to access the Documents and Settings Folder in Vista Home Premium. In
Windows Explorer, I looked at the Properties of this folder by right clicking
on the folder and selecting Properties. Under the Sharing tab, it says not
shared. So I clicked Advanced Sharing, then put a check next to Share this
Folder and then clicked Apply at the bottom. The following error message
appears: "An error occurred while trying to share Documents and Settings.
Access is denied. The shared resource was not created at this time." I also
checked the Security Tab and applied full control to Everyone, System, and
Administrators. Can anyone tell me how to access this folder? I want to put a
folder into C:/Documents and Settings/All Users/Application
Data/Adobe/Photoshop Elements/5.0/Photo Creations/Special Effects.

Re: How to Access Documents and Settings Folder in Vista Home Premium

Hello,

normally, the "Documents and Settings" folder is called "Users" under Windows Vista. Is this folder from an older installation, like from Windows XP?

Re: How to Access Documents and Settings Folder in Vista Home Premium

In Vista that folder is redirected to %systemdrive%\ProgramData\adobe.
%systemdrive% is usual C:\
